  Although English is not as old as Chinese, it is spoken by many people around the world every day.English speakers are always making up new words, and we are often able to know where most come from.

  Sometimes, however, no one may really know where a word comes from.Did you ever think about why hamburgers are called“hamburgers”, especially when they are not made with ham(火腿)?About a hundred years ago, some men went to America from Europe.They came from a big city in Germany called Hamburg.They didn't speak good English, but they ate good food.When some Americans saw them eating round pieces of beef, they asked the Germans what they were.The Germans didn't understand the question and answered,“We come from Hamburg.”One of these Americans owned a restaurant, and had an idea.He cooked some round pieces of bread with beef in them and started selling them.Such bread came to be called“hamburgers”.Today,“Hamburgers”are sold in many countries around the world.

  Whether this story is true or not, it certainly is interesting.Knowing why any word has a certain meaning is interesting, too.This reason, for most English words, can be found in any large English dictionary.

Most children with healthy appetites(食欲) are ready to eat almost anything that is offered to them. A child often likes food unless it is badly cooked. The way a meal is cooked and served is most important and an attractively served meal will often improve a child's appetite. Never ask a child whether he likes or dislikes a food and never discuss likes and dislikes in front of him or allow anybody else to do so. If the father says that he hates fat meat or the mother refuses some vegetables in the child's hearing, he may copy this action. Parents should agree to the fact that he likes everything and he probably will. Nothing healthy should be got out of from the meal because of a supposed dislike. At meal times it is a good idea to give a child a small part and let him come back for a second helping rather than give him as much as he may eat all at once. Do not talk too much to the child during meal times, but let him get on with his food; and do not allow him to leave the table at once after a meal, or he will soon learn to eat his food hurriedly so he can hurry back to the toys in his room. On no condition(任何情況下都不) must a child be coaxed(哄騙) or made to eat.
